Gernot Rohr has owned up that Super Eagles defenders will not be able to stop Bayern Munich goal man, Robert Lewandowski from scoring when they meet at the Municipal Stadium on Friday, March 23.
The Super Eagles coach believes that the Poland captain is in the same bracket as 2 of the most dangerous strikers in the world, Barcelona superstar Lionel Messi & Real Madrid's Portuguese sensation Cristiano Ronaldo.
Rohr told journalists: ”This cannot be done. We can only make him score as few goals as possible. With him is like with Messi, they just cannot be excluded from the game.
”Lewandowski, next to Messi and Ronaldo, is one of the three best players in the world. Among the central attackers number one. ”
Rohr hinted that he’ll prefer if the Poland coach, Adam Nawalka includes Lewandowski in the starting line-up for the upcoming friendly game, saying this will prepare the super eagles for the game against Argentina's deadly duo Messi and Aguero at the FIFA World Cup.
”I hope that your team will go to the field in the strongest lineup. I am counting on Lewandowski's performance.
”Battling with such an attacker is to prepare my players to be able to face Messi and Agüero during the World Cup.
”Besides, I do not hide that I like him a lot, because he plays in Bayern, and I also played in this team,” he added.
